JAKARTA - Google provides a neater redesign for its keyboard app, Gboard. By moving some buttons and interface elements (UI) to make the emoji search experience more natural.

Currently the redesign is still in beta. Where, if the user taps the emoji button on the Gboard, they will see a new persistent bar at the top with the search box, the return button, and the mentioned page name.

Talking about the changes, the All tab remains unchanged, but the Emoji tab accepts most changes. Emoji voters are now under the top bar and less stacked.

Now, Search and Category are placed first on the panel. Sticker tabs in the top bar are now not too crowded. GIF and Emoticon tabs are also in line with UI, and search features get the same UI.

Launching 9to5Google, Friday, November 11, one strange change found was that the ABC button was not in the lower left corner. Using this ABC button, users can easily return to the keyboard but that button has been removed.

If users want to return to the font display, they should press the top left return button. Furthermore, Google is now showing an Emoji Kitchen sticker within the emoji voter, not above it.

Currently, the redesign of Gboard emoji voters appears for many beta users. This new design hasn't rolled out to a wider user yet. So, if users want to try out this new redesign, they should be beta testers for the Gboard app, which can be done from the Google Play Store.
